Disability income protection insurance is designed to protect your employment income, by providing a monthly benefit when disability restricts your ability to work.
Each income protection plan is different. You can choose an accident-only plan or a plan that insures against a disability caused by either an accident or a sickness.
You can also choose your "commencement date". In choosing a commencement date, you'll need to decide how long you can live on your own resources during a disability before benefits start. The later the commencement date, the lower your premium.
Depending on the plan you choose, you could be provided with income after you are disabled for 30, 60, 90, 120, 180 days or even a year or two years after the start of a disability.
